H.Res. 1093 (109th)

Waiving a requirement of clause 6(a) of rule XIII with respect to consideration of certain resolutions reported from the Committee on Rules.

Summary

Waives the requirement of Rule XIII of the House of Representatives for a two-thirds vote to consider a report from the Committee on Rules on the same day it is presented to the House with respect to any resolution reported on December 6, 2006, providing for consideration of a bill to to extend certain expiring provisions the Internal Revenue Code.
